  • An Open Letter to the FWC Commissioners

    Commissioners, I wanted to reach out to your prior to this week’s Commission meetings in Panama City Beach. I wish I could be there. I tried. I pushed hard. I’ve been to the past 4-5 meetings, but, as a full-time waterfowl guide, this one was tough to pull off. See, I have a client flying in to hunt the day of the meetings from out of state. This gentleman has harvested 42 species of waterfowl, and only needs the Florida mottled duck to complete his slam. We’ve planned the hunt since June.   • Bacon Wrapped Dove

    Anything wrapped in bacon is good, right? The answer is a resounding “YES,”  but especially when it comes to dove. I’m willing to bet that most doves killed in the US get made into some form of jalapeno popper (not that there is anything wrong with that), but these little birds are so good in so many different ways! This recipe is how I cooked the last doves I had, and they were excellent! Add some butter, Worcestershire sauce, and a little seasoning and you have yourself the makings of a great meal!   • Recipes: Fried Honey Buns

    We’ve talked about it for 2 weeks, so we decided it was time to put a marker down.  Here’s the recipe for the greatest breakfast snack of all time – fried Honey Buns. Credit goes to Josh Raggio of Raggio Custom Calls for bringing this culinary delight to our attention. It’s also important to note that these are not DEEP FRIED Honey Buns – that is a bit much! These are much healthier than those!* Ingredients: Box of Little Debbie Honey Buns Bacon Grease Directions: This ain’t rocket science, y’all. Get your bacon grease hot, add in the honey buns (unwrapped), cook for about 90 seconds per side.  Serve warm.…
